What the Jordan record actually contains

Jordan’s UFO record is best read in three layers. The first is the small civilian-sighting layer: isolated reports of lights or formations, usually without radar data, photographs, independent witness statements or official follow-up. The second is the security layer: official or semi-official reports of flying objects, drones, missiles, suspicious aerial movements and debris, especially around Jordan’s borders with Syria, Iraq, Israel and the Red Sea area. The third is the folklore-and-media layer, where social platforms, recycled clips and sensational wording can turn ordinary uncertainty into a claim of alien craft.

Overview image for What Counts as a UFO in Jordan? That layered reading is essential because Jordan’s own geography makes sky interpretation difficult. The kingdom has 12 governorates, a large dry and semi-arid landscape, and a single short Red Sea outlet at Aqaba, while also bordering Syria, Iraq, Saudi Arabia and the occupied Palestinian territories; those facts place it under both excellent night-sky viewing conditions and intense regional security pressures. The modern term “UAP”, meaning unidentified anomalous phenomena, is useful here because it avoids assuming aliens. NASA’s current public guidance is blunt: there is no data supporting the idea that UAP are evidence of alien technologies, and most sightings lack enough data to draw firm scientific conclusions. [NASA Science]science.nasa.govScience UAP FAQsScience UAP FAQs Applied to Jordan, that means the fair question is not “were aliens seen?”, but “what was reported, by whom, with what supporting evidence, and what ordinary or security-related explanations remain plausible?”

Chronology of notable Jordan-linked cases

The Jordan Valley formation report, 2000

One of the more detailed Jordan-linked civilian UFO reports in an international database comes from the Jordan Valley near the Jordan River and Dead Sea area. The National UFO Reporting Center, a US-based private reporting organisation founded in 1974 that says it has processed more than 180,000 reports, lists a Jordan Valley report said to have occurred on 15 July 2000 and to have been submitted in 2003. [NUFORC]nuforc.orgAbout Us | NUFORCAbout Us | NUFORC

The report describes three bright, star-like lights forming a vibrating triangle, rotating, then separating. It is unusually long and includes follow-up correspondence. The submitter said the account came through a relative rather than from the primary witness directly, and NUFORC’s note explicitly raised the possibility of projected or advertising lights while saying that possibility would need to be ruled out. [NUFORC]nuforc.orgOpen source on nuforc.org.

That makes the case interesting but weak as evidence. It has a named region, a narrative with movement details, and an attempt by the database editor to ask about alternative explanations. But it also has major limitations: the date is approximate, the direct witness did not provide the English-language report, there is no known instrument record, and no official Jordanian investigation is cited. In a Jordan chronology, it belongs in the “contested/unresolved report” category, not the “confirmed anomaly” category.

The Jafr April Fool’s panic, 2010

The clearest Jordanian UFO “case” is also the easiest to classify: a hoax. In April 2010, Associated Press reporting carried by SFGate described how Jordanian newspaper Al Ghad published an April Fool’s Day front-page story about a fake UFO landing near Jafr, a desert town roughly 300 kilometres from Amman. The article said flying saucers had lit up the town, interrupted communications and frightened residents. [SFGATE]sfgate.comFake April 1 alien story sparks panic in JordanFake April 1 alien story sparks panic in Jordan

The impact was real even though the story was false. Jafr’s mayor, Mohammed Mleihan, said he sent security authorities to look for the aliens, considered evacuation, and complained that students stayed away from school because families were frightened. [SFGATE]sfgate.comFake April 1 alien story sparks panic in JordanFake April 1 alien story sparks panic in Jordan

This episode matters because it shows how Jordanian UFO narratives can move quickly from entertainment into public-order consequences. It is not evidence for a sighting, but it is strong evidence for the social life of UFO claims: local authority, media trust, desert remoteness and fear can turn a joke into an emergency-style response.

Border and air-defence incidents, 2024

From 2024 onward, Jordan’s “unidentified object” record becomes much more security-centred. In April 2024, during Iran’s drone and missile attack on Israel, Jordan said it intercepted flying objects that entered its airspace to protect citizens; Al Jazeera reported that some shrapnel fell in multiple locations without significant damage or injuries, and that Jordan had reopened its airspace after the regional closures. [Al Jazeera]aljazeera.comSource details in endnotes. Reuters likewise reported that Jordan intercepted objects after Iran launched drones and missiles, with Jordan positioned directly between Iran-linked launch routes and Israel. [Reuters]reuters.comJordan says it intercepted flying objects that entered its airspaceJordan says it intercepted flying objects that entered its airspace

In March 2024, Reuters reported another Jordanian military statement: air-defence radar had detected suspicious aerial movements of unknown source near the Syrian border, prompting an air force response. A regional security source told Reuters the movements were probably missiles fired by pro-Iranian militias from Iraq, and witnesses reported aircraft over Irbid and areas near the Syrian border. [Reuters]reuters.comJordan army detects suspicious aerial movement near Syria borderJordan army detects suspicious aerial movement near Syria border

These are “unidentified” in a military and operational sense, not in the classic flying-saucer sense. They show Jordan’s air-defence environment becoming a place where uncertain radar tracks, drones, missiles, interceptors and falling fragments can all enter public discussion under UFO-adjacent language.

The Aqaba object, November 2024

On 18 November 2024, the Jordan Armed Forces issued a statement saying that an unidentified flying object had crashed early that morning in a border area within Aqaba Governorate in southern Jordan. The statement said there were no material or human casualties, and that a military engineering reconnaissance team and civil defence personnel had reached the site. It also warned citizens not to approach or tamper with such objects. [Jordan Armed Forces]jaf.mil.joThe General Command of the jordanian armed forces the arab army…

This is the strongest kind of Jordanian “UFO” record in one narrow sense: it is official, dated and geographically specific. But it is not strong evidence for anything exotic. Anadolu Agency reported the same incident as a “flying object” falling near southern Israel, noting that Aqaba is adjacent to Eilat, an area that had been targeted by drone attacks from Yemeni and Iraqi groups; the report also said the Jordanian statement did not specify the object’s origin or whether it had been downed by an interceptor. [Anadolu Agency]aa.com.trAnadolu Agency'Flying object' falls in southern Jordan without causingAnadolu Agency'Flying object' falls in southern Jordan without causing

The most cautious interpretation is that this was an unidentified aerial object in a conflict-zone airspace context. Until an official technical identification is public, it remains unresolved at the level of object type, not evidence of anomalous technology.

Amman and social-media-era light reports, 2022–2025

Amman appears in online UFO discussion mainly through videos and individual witness posts. A Reddit post from 2022, for example, described a triangular-shaped UFO or UAP over Amman at 3:47 a.m., but the available search result points to archived social discussion rather than a verified investigation. [Reddit]reddit.comTriangular-shaped #UFO #UAP sighted flying overTriangular-shaped #UFO #UAP sighted flying over

A more structured entry appears in NUFORC’s database for 18 July 2025: one observer in Amman reported two white star-like objects, one vanishing while the other gained altitude and changed colour, over 10–15 seconds. The entry gives direction, elevation, estimated distance and reported colour change, but it remains a single-witness report with no cited official confirmation. [NUFORC]nuforc.orgOpen source on nuforc.org.

These Amman reports are worth recording because they show that Jordan has contemporary civilian UFO reporting. They are not, however, strong evidence. Short-duration star-like lights can be satellites, aircraft, drones, meteors, re-entering debris, atmospheric effects or military activity, and without time-synchronised video, multiple independent witnesses or sensor records, the evidential ceiling remains low.

Missile, drone and debris reports, 2025

By June 2025, Jordan’s skies were again part of regional missile and drone activity. Al Arabiya reported that Jordan’s military said it had intercepted drones and missiles that violated the kingdom’s airspace on 13 June 2025. [Al Arabiya English]english.alarabiya.netSource details in endnotes. Asharq Al-Awsat reported that three people were injured in Irbid when an unspecified object fell on a home, in the context of Iranian missiles and drones fired towards Israel crossing Jordanian airspace. [Arab News]arabnews.pkmiddle eastmiddle east

Roya News also published video-item pages about missiles, flying objects and unidentified objects falling in places such as Jerash forests, explicitly linking some of these incidents to regional hostilities and missile exchanges. [Royanews]en.royanews.tvOpen source on royanews.tv. These are not classic UFO cases, but they are now central to how Jordanians may experience “strange things in the sky”: flashes, interceptions, smoke trails, falling fragments and emergency sirens can be visible to civilians before they are fully identified.

Why Jordan produces more sky confusion than UFO evidence

Jordan has several conditions that can make ordinary or military aerial phenomena look extraordinary. Wadi Rum is a good example. Its isolation, elevation and low light pollution make the Milky Way and meteor activity unusually vivid to visitors; Condé Nast Traveler described the desert sky as exceptionally clear, with meteor showers such as the Perseids and Geminids among the visible highlights. [Condé Nast Traveler]cntraveler.comSource details in endnotes. Local stargazing operators similarly emphasise Wadi Rum’s dark skies, clear summer nights and strong meteor-shower viewing conditions. [Wadi Rum Nomads]wadirumnomads.comWadi Rum Nomads See the Stunning Perseid Meteor Shower in Wadi Rum, JordanWadi Rum Nomads See the Stunning Perseid Meteor Shower in Wadi Rum, Jordan

That cuts both ways. Dark skies help observers see more real celestial activity, but they can also make satellites, meteors and aircraft lights appear more dramatic than they would in a light-polluted city. A bright meteor over Wadi Rum or the Jordan Valley may be remembered as a silent falling object; a line of satellites may look like a formation; an aircraft on approach may appear to hover when seen head-on.

The more distinctive Jordanian factor is regional security. Jordan sits between multiple conflict theatres and flight corridors. In 2024 and 2025, official and journalistic sources repeatedly described drones, missiles, suspicious aerial movements, airspace closures and falling debris. [Al Jazeera]aljazeera.comSource details in endnotes. Reuters That means modern Jordanian UFO assessment must start with air-defence context before reaching for exotic hypotheses. Evidence quality: confirmed, contested and debunked

The Jordan record becomes clearer when the cases are separated by evidence type.

Confirmed as real-world events, but not anomalous craft: The April 2024 interceptions, March 2024 suspicious aerial movements, November 2024 Aqaba crash statement and June 2025 missile/drone/debris reports all describe real security events or official responses. Their “unidentified” status usually means the object’s origin, type or trajectory was not publicly specified at first, not that it behaved beyond known technology. [Al Arabiya English]english.alarabiya.netSource details in endnotes. [Jordan Armed Forces]jaf.mil.joThe General Command of the jordanian armed forces the arab army… [Al Jazeera]aljazeera.comOpen source on aljazeera.com.

Contested or unresolved civilian sightings: The 2000 Jordan Valley formation report and the 2025 Amman star-like-light report are unresolved in the weak sense: there is not enough public evidence to prove a conventional explanation or an anomalous one. NUFORC’s own Jordan Valley note shows the right sceptical instinct by raising projected lights as a possibility, while the Amman case remains a single-observer short-duration report. [NUFORC]nuforc.orgOpen source on nuforc.org.

Debunked or non-evidential claims: The 2010 Jafr case is a confirmed hoax, not a sighting. Social media posts and sensational pages about Wadi Rum or Amman sightings may be useful leads, but they should not be treated as verified unless they connect to primary footage, independent witnesses, local reporting, flight data, astronomical timing or official comment. [SFGATE]sfgate.comFake April 1 alien story sparks panic in JordanFake April 1 alien story sparks panic in Jordan

This split also explains why Jordan does not currently have a strong public archive of declassified UFO investigations. The closest official material is not a UFO archive in the classic sense, but military, civil-defence and aviation-security reporting around unidentified or hostile aerial objects. For historical UFO-style sightings, the public trail is mostly private databases and media fragments.

How to read future Jordan UFO claims

A useful Jordan-specific test begins with location. Aqaba, Irbid, Jerash and border regions should immediately raise the possibility of drones, missiles, interceptors, military aircraft or debris. Wadi Rum, the Jordan Valley and desert camps should raise the possibility of meteors, satellites, planets and unusual visibility. Amman adds urban factors: aircraft approaches, drones, reflections, rooftop lights and short clips stripped of context.

The next test is timing. A claim made during a regional escalation, airspace closure or siren alert is much more likely to involve known conflict-related activity than an unknown aerial phenomenon in the scientific sense. Conversely, a summer desert sighting during the Perseids or another meteor shower should be checked against astronomical calendars before being treated as unexplained.

The final test is evidence. A strong Jordan case would need more than a dramatic description: exact time and location, original video metadata, compass direction, elevation, duration, multiple independent witnesses, flight-tracking checks, satellite-pass checks, meteor data and any official civil-defence or military statement. Without those, the honest classification is usually “reported unidentified light” or “unidentified object in a security context”, not “confirmed UFO” in the popular extraterrestrial sense.

Bottom line for Jordan

Jordan’s UFO picture is not empty, but it is often misunderstood. The country has a handful of civilian sighting reports, a memorable debunked media panic, and a growing set of official or journalistic references to unidentified aerial objects in a tense regional airspace. The most evidence-backed Jordan cases point towards military and security uncertainty, not alien visitation. The most intriguing civilian reports remain under-documented. The most useful conclusion is therefore cautious: Jordan is a good place to study how dark skies, border security, regional conflict and online UFO culture overlap, but the public record does not currently support any confirmed extraordinary aerial craft over the kingdom.
